Design And Research Of Intelligent Feeding System For Industrial Recirculating Aquaculture

In recent years,China has paid more and more attention to the aquaculture industry,and put aquaculture into the "maritime silk road" plan and started the development of Marine fishery.Among them,the factory recirculating aquaculture model is a new type of aquaculture model.Its high efficiency is based on the core characteristics of recirculating water.It has the advantages of water saving,electricity saving and land saving.It has become the direction and research hotspot of sustainable development of aquaculture.Feed feeding,as an important part of circulating water in factories,still needs to be done manually at this stage.In order to solve the shortcomings of manual feeding in multi-layer tank industrial aquaculture mode,such as limited operating space,high working intensity and low feed utilization rate,an intelligent feeding system for industrial circulating aquaculture is designed in this paper.The system is based on K60 single-chip microprocessor,to follow the trail of trolley and feed.The feeding device and control system are composed of parts.The system runs on a specific feeding runway.According to the track information collected by the infrared tube and the feed information collected by the pressure sensor,the feeding or feeding can be judged,and then the intelligent fixed-point quantitative feeding can be realized.The preliminary test results show that the system runs steadily and reliably with a speed of 0.5-2.2m/s,a feeding positioning error of less than 2cm and a feeding error of less than 10 g,which basically meets the design requirements.
